A new security incident has emerged involving the malicious elementary-data package version 0.23.3, which has been found to steal sensitive developer information and cryptocurrency wallet credentials. The attack took advantage of a flaw in GitHub Actions scripts, allowing the attacker to inject shell code that exposed a GitHub token. This means that anyone using this version of the package could be at risk, potentially compromising their projects and financial assets. Recent legislation has sparked bipartisan criticism as it reauthorizes Section 702 of the Foreign Intelligence Surveillance Act for another three years. House Speaker Mike Johnson introduced this bill after a brief 10-day extension was approved, following unsuccessful attempts to secure an 18-month renewal. Critics from both political parties express concerns about privacy and the implications of ongoing surveillance practices. This legislation allows government agencies to collect foreign intelligence, but opponents argue it risks infringing on the rights of American citizens. Udemy, a popular e-learning platform, has reportedly suffered a data breach involving more than 1.4 million user records. The ShinyHunters group, known for extortion tactics, claimed responsibility and is threatening to release the stolen data if Udemy does not engage in negotiations by April 27. This breach raises concerns for users about the potential exposure of personal information, which could lead to identity theft or phishing attacks. A 19-year-old dual citizen of the United States and Estonia has been arrested in Finland and is facing federal charges in the U.S. for his alleged involvement with the Scattered Spider hacking group. This collective is known for its sophisticated cyberattacks, often targeting high-profile organizations. The arrest marks a significant step in the fight against cybercrime, as Scattered Spider has been linked to various data breaches and online scams. In 2025, U.S. state privacy regulators imposed $3.425 billion in fines on companies for privacy violations, nearly doubling the $1.827 billion collected in 2024. This significant increase reflects a growing trend in enforcement actions linked to state and federal privacy laws, as noted by Gartner. The surge in fines indicates that regulators are becoming more aggressive in holding companies accountable for mishandling personal data. A serious security flaw has been identified in LeRobot, Hugging Face's open-source robotics platform, which has garnered nearly 24,000 stars on GitHub. The vulnerability, designated as CVE-2026-25874, has a high severity score of 9.3 and allows attackers to exploit untrusted data deserialization, potentially leading to remote code execution without authentication. This flaw poses a significant risk to developers and organizations using LeRobot, as it could allow unauthorized access and control over their systems. Researchers have identified a new group of 73 malicious extensions linked to the GlassWorm campaign, which are designed to mimic legitimate projects. These extensions have been activated on Open VSX, a marketplace for Visual Studio Code extensions. The attackers aim to deceive users into installing these fake extensions, potentially compromising their systems. This incident raises concerns for developers and organizations using Open VSX, as it exposes them to security risks if they inadvertently install these malicious add-ons.
